I got my first mustang in 2007, Tungsten gray V6. It went through a few changes and I decided to go to a GT500 style look. I had the whole GT500 body kit, Brembo front brakes, GT500 black/red interior including the dash, steering wheel. If you looked at her “Eleanor” you would’ve thought it was a GT500. I had the engine swapped to an 08 Bullitt engine/transmission. I loved my daily driver. Then in April this year it was totaled from a hit and run driver in a stolen vehicle. I’ve since gotten a 2016 Kia Soul EV+ I like my Soul but I miss Eleanor. One day I’ll be back in a mustang but not any time soon.
I’ve got a bunch of parts I never installed that I have to go through and sell off (some can be used from 05-14 mustangs others are 05-10 GT)

I still have my 2015 GT. It's not quite stock any longer though. I've added an Airaid CAI, MBRP exhaust, GT350 Track Pack spoiler and a custom 93 octane peformance tune. I also did some custom painting of the intake cover.
